British Gas is giving people free hot water as part of major new trial to slash bills
BRITISH Gas is trialling a new way to pump homes with hot water, which could drastically cut down household bills.
The energy giant, which powers about 7 million homes in the UK, is using the leftover energy from computer servers to heat water.


Computer servers can generate a lot of warmth.
All of the data they process makes the machines whirr and produce hot air.
Think about how hot your laptop can get – and then imagine a warehouse full of them. That’s a lot of heat.
And currently, most of that heat is being blown away by cooling fans inside the data centres.
Wasted heat is a problem for data centres, because it requires a lot of money and energy to cool.
But cloud computing provider Heata, which has partnered with British Gas, wants to put mini data processing units on hot water cylinders at home.
These units process Heata’s cloud computing workloads, while providing free hot water without using any gas.
The technology is expected to shave up to £350 off your annual hot water bill if you use electric, according to Heata, and up to £120 on gas-heated water.
It does mean you’ll have to install a hot water cylinder, however, as it can’t be used on a combi boiler.
The pair will be trialling this new method on 10 British Gas customers over the next three months.
“Innovative projects like this are another example of how the UK is becoming a leader in cutting carbon emissions,” Paul Lodwidge, Head of Energy Product & Propositions from British Gas, said in a statement.
The trial will help British Gas and Heata work out just how effective mini data centres at home could heat water, and slash energy bills.
The pair will also “co-develop customer propositions in 2025”, a statement from Centrica, British Gas’ parent company, said.
Demon appliances that drain your energy on standby
Appliances around the home can quietly guzzle energy adding extra pounds to your bill when you are not getting any use from them.
This can cost you a typical £45 a year but can be even more if you have a lot of appliances plugged in.
Here is a list of appliances that you should make sure are fully switched off or unplugged at the mains when not in use.
- Television
Leaving your TV on standby all the time can feel easier, but is costing you in the long term.
- Desktop computer
Keeping your computer switched on or on standby when you’re not using it wastes energy
- Microwave
A microwave is one of the appliances that will eat up electricity when left on standby. Unplug it from the walls and you could save money on your energy bill
- Outdoor security lights
Security lights can deter burglars by turning on automatically once someone is nearby.
But oversensitive lighting that turns on too easily can see you pay extra.
- Electric towel rail
An electric towel rail can warm up your towels or help dry your clothes.
But there is a price to pay for this comfort, especially if it isn’t being used.
Eva Longoria reveals the Cannes red carpet blunder she’ll always regret & her secrets to great style in your 40s
EVA Longoria has revealed all on her school run style and biggest fashion regret, as well as the top beauty secrets she swears by.
The 49-year-old Hollywood actress also got candid on her celebrity “style icon”, as well as the wardrobe item she has “way too many” of but just can’t throw away.




Speaking to The Times, the brunette beauty, who describes her style as “muted” as a result of her love of “classic styles and comfort”, explained that she admired her mother, aunt and sisters’ style when growing up.
She confessed: “I never had to look far for an example of what a woman should be. I had really great role models in my family.
“My aunt was well travelled and always wore a scarf and perfume. She was – and is – so glamorous. That’s what I wanted to be like.”
Whilst she looked up to her family members for fashion advice, now, her celeb pal, Victoria Beckham, 50, is her go-to.
Eva beamed: “[Victoria Beckham] is my style icon. I aspire to be like her one day, and I never will.”
For those eager to look inside Eva’s wardrobe, you’re sure to find “way too many” pairs of white trainers.
But whilst Eva’s businessman husband José Bastón thinks her collection of similar shoes is excessive, the Desperate Housewives star claimed: “But I need them. I can’t say out loud how many I have.”
When it comes to the secret to red carpet dressing, Eva praised her hair, make-up and stylist team, as she explained: “They put so much thought into it that I don’t have to. They pull photos and references and create the illusion that is Eva Longoria.”
But for those without a load of professionals to hand, if you want great style in your forties, Eva advised: “I think less trendy, more classic and more investment pieces that will last longer. You can justify that expense over the years of wear you’ll get out of it.”
Whilst Eva is often dressed up to the nines for posh celeb events, when it comes to dropping off her six-year-old Ssantiago Enrique Bastón to school, Eva simply confirmed that her style is “sweats or yoga pants.”.
But despite keeping it simple for the school run, when it comes to her skincare routine, you can expect a host of pricey gadgets.
The beauty enthusiast opened up: “I’m currently obsessed with the TheraFace Pro [£375]. It’s this machine, it turns hot and cold and you can de-puff your eyes. It is the greatest invention ever.
I’m Mexican so I have great hair
Eva Longoria
“I also like the Facify Beauty Wand [£345] to use on my face.”
But where her luscious locks are concerned, she simply confirmed: “Well, I’m Mexican so I have great hair.”

And although we think Eva always looks fabulous whatever the occasion, the savvy mum was eager to open up on her biggest outfit regret which still haunts her, all 20 years later.
Reflecting on the 2005 red carpet, Eva shared: “The first time I went to the Cannes Film Festival sticks out. I went to Melrose Avenue in Los Angeles and bought a $39 [£31] dress because I was told I needed a dress.
“It looked amazing and people were like, “Who are you wearing?” I thought, why are they asking me that? It was this gold knit dress and even L’Oréal were like, “Maybe next time we style you.” I really didn’t understand the gravity of that red carpet.”
